Private Taxi Services: Convenience at Your Fingertips
For those prioritising privacy, flexibility, and a direct route, private taxi services are an excellent choice. This option provides a dedicated vehicle, often a comfortable car or SUV, that picks you up directly from your accommodation in Hoi An and drops you off precisely where you need to be in Da Nang. The convenience of a private transfer is unparalleled, particularly if you're travelling with luggage, family, or prefer a quieter journey.
Reviewers frequently highlight the efficiency and safety of private taxi services. For instance, Knut P praised a taxi SUV service, describing it as "safe and efficient 🤩" with a "very nice and attentive driver." This feedback underscores the personal touch and reliability often associated with private bookings. Drivers are typically punctual, ensuring you depart on time and arrive at your destination without unnecessary delays. The directness of the route means you can often reach your destination even sooner than estimated, a definite bonus for tight schedules.
However, it's worth noting that while private taxis offer superior convenience, they can sometimes be a bit more expensive than shared options. Felix Z, for example, found a taxi service "maybe a bit more expensive than usual..." This is generally to be expected when opting for a personalised service. Another point to consider, though less common, is the vehicle's condition or environment. Diana M, in one instance, mentioned that "The car smelled of cigarettes." While this isn't typical of most reputable operators, it's a reminder to choose well-regarded companies and, if possible, confirm preferences when booking.
Companies like Mango Travel (as cited by Knut P) and OUROS Travel (from Felix Z and Diana M's experiences) are among those operating private taxi services between the two cities. When booking, clear communication about pick-up times, locations, and any specific requirements is key. Many operators facilitate this through easy-to-use booking platforms or direct messaging services like WhatsApp.
For budget-conscious travellers or those who don't mind sharing their ride, shared shuttle and minibus services present a highly viable and popular alternative. These services operate on a fixed schedule, picking up passengers from designated points or directly from their hotels and consolidating them into a larger vehicle, such as a van or minibus, before heading to Da Nang. The ease of communication and the overall seamless experience are frequently lauded by users.
A recurring theme in reviews for shared services is the excellent communication from the operating companies. Katrina Z reported, "Received a WhatsApp message confirming my booking and another message with the plate number of the van," indicating proactive and helpful communication. Similarly, Wanjiku G highlighted "great communication a day or 2 prior to your transfer," ensuring travellers are well-informed and prepared. This level of detail significantly reduces any anxiety about finding your ride or confirming arrangements.
Punctuality is another strong suit of these shared services. Jorge S described his experience as "Excellent service, it was punctual and arrived to the destination before estimated time." Louis B simply stated, "All on time, very helpful." This consistent reliability makes shared shuttles a dependable choice for those needing to adhere to a schedule, such as catching a flight from Da Nang International Airport.
Operators like "Hoi An Food Tour" (which appears to offer shuttle services despite its name) and "April Adventure" are frequently mentioned by satisfied customers. These companies are often praised for being "very accommodating to pick & drop you as close to your accommodation as possible," a significant benefit that minimises walking with luggage. The journey itself is typically quick; Wanjiku G noted, the "quick ride didn't even feel like an hour drive."
One remarkable anecdote shared by Jorge S illustrates the exceptional customer service some of these companies provide: "I forgot my sunglasses in the vehicle and it was easy to communicate with them, and they sent them directly to my hotel. Amazing service, highly recommended." This goes beyond mere transport, highlighting a commitment to customer care that builds trust and loyalty.
Key Considerations for Your Transfer
Regardless of whether you choose a private taxi or a shared shuttle, several factors contribute to a smooth and enjoyable transfer from Hoi An to Da Nang:
Booking & Communication: The reviews strongly suggest that companies utilising WhatsApp or similar messaging apps for pre-transfer communication (confirmations, vehicle details, driver contact) enhance the overall experience. Prior communication ensures peace of mind and reduces the chances of miscommunication.
Punctuality: Most services, both private and shared, are highly punctual. Drivers arrive on time, if not early, and strive to get you to your destination efficiently. Building in a small buffer, especially for airport transfers, is always a wise precaution.
Comfort & Vehicle Type: While both options offer comfort, private taxis (like SUVs) generally provide more space and privacy. Shared shuttles (vans, minibuses) are comfortable enough for the short journey. Be aware of the stated capacity (e.g., "SUV 4pax," "Comfort 3pax," "Minibus 12") to manage expectations regarding space.
Cost-Effectiveness: Shared shuttles are generally cheaper per person. Private taxis offer value through exclusivity and directness. Katrina Z found her van transfer to be "easy and cheaper transportation," indicating that even private-like services can be competitive.
Customer Service: The ability to communicate easily, receive timely updates, and even retrieve forgotten items (as demonstrated by Jorge S's experience) speaks volumes about the quality of service. Prioritise companies known for their responsiveness and helpfulness.
Choosing Your Ideal Ride: A Comparison
To help you make an informed decision, here's a comparative overview of private taxi services versus shared shuttle/bus services:
| Feature | Private Taxi Services | Shared Shuttle/Bus Services |
|---|---|---|
| Cost | Generally higher per person | More affordable per person |
| Privacy | High; exclusive use of vehicle | Shared with other passengers |
| Convenience | Door-to-door, direct, flexible pickup time | Door-to-door or designated pickup points, fixed schedules |
| Speed | Often slightly faster due to direct route | Efficient, but may involve multiple stops |
| Booking | Easy via online platforms or direct contact | Easy via online platforms, often with WhatsApp communication |
| Luggage | Ample space, no issues with multiple bags | Adequate space, but very large or excessive luggage might require prior notice |
| Suitability | Families, groups, those preferring exclusivity, tight schedules, airport transfers | Solo travellers, couples, budget-conscious, those happy to share |
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Given the popularity of this route, many common questions arise for travellers. Here are some answers based on typical experiences:
How long does the journey typically take from Hoi An to Da Nang?
The journey between Hoi An and Da Nang is quite short, usually taking between 45 minutes to an hour, depending on traffic conditions and your exact drop-off location in Da Nang. Wanjiku G noted, it "didn't even feel like an hour drive," which is a common sentiment.
Are transfers between Hoi An and Da Nang reliable?
Yes, based on numerous traveller experiences, the transfers are highly reliable. Companies frequently provide excellent communication, drivers are punctual, and vehicles are generally well-maintained. The strong emphasis on customer satisfaction means most services strive for punctuality and efficiency.
Can I book a transfer last minute?
While it's often possible to find a transfer on short notice, especially for taxis, it's always recommended to book at least a day or two in advance, particularly for shared shuttles or during peak travel seasons. This ensures availability and allows the company to arrange the best pick-up schedule for you. The "great communication a day or 2 prior to your transfer" mentioned by Wanjiku G indicates this is standard practice.
What is the best way to communicate with the transfer company or driver?
Many companies prefer and utilise WhatsApp for communication, sending booking confirmations, driver details, and vehicle plate numbers. This method is highly efficient and widely used in Vietnam. Having a local SIM card or reliable Wi-Fi access for WhatsApp is highly recommended.
What if I forget something in the vehicle?
As demonstrated by Jorge S's experience, reputable companies are often very helpful in such situations. If you realise you've left an item behind, immediately contact the company through the number provided in your booking confirmation. Clear communication and a quick response from your side will increase the chances of retrieving your belongings.
Are there night transfers available?
Most private taxi and some shuttle services operate late into the evening or even through the night, especially to accommodate airport arrivals or departures. It's best to confirm the operating hours with your chosen provider when booking, particularly for very early or late transfers.
